The best and worst energy drinks
Late nights, early morning, and hectic lifestyles are a recipe for exhaustion. Many people wake up tired, hit a wall midafternoon, and fantasize nap. A popular response to this lack of sleep is turning to energy drinks for an extra boost to make it through the day. Everyone has their favorite, but not all are created equal! We take a look at the best energy drinks - and worst energy drinks - out there and this is what we found:
Top 4 Worst energy drinks
# 4: Soda
the draw is caffeine and sugar content of sodium, which do not give a temporary boost of energy. The problem is the amount of sugar in these drinks: A 12-ounce can has an average of 33 grams, which is 8 grams more than the WHO recommendation for an entire day. As a result, the sugar causes your body to sleep after an hour because all that sugar becomes stored fat.
# 3: Fancy Coffees
A coffee drink mixed with flavored milk or may taste delicious, but turning to these energy drinks is a bad idea. A typical Starbucks Frappuccino has more sugar than a can of soda (46 grams) and almost three times more caffeine (108 mg in a Frappuccino compared with 29 grams of sodium). Canned or bottled coffee drinks are not much better.
# 2: The popular energy drinks
Red Bull, bass drum, Amp, Rockstar, Full Throttle, Monster ... are all similar and is not a good choice. All have about 200 calories, 50 grams of sugar and 50 grams of carbohydrate (20% of DV) per can. The caffeine content varies, but can be almost 300 mg per can. These drinks are linked to nausea, increased heart rate, and abdominal pain. Most of these companies are dealing with demands due to deaths related to energy drinks.
# 1: 5 hours of power
Marketed as a "dietary supplement", these small bottles caffeinated, low calorie, sugar free, and is supposed to include vitamins. However, because it is a dietary supplement, 5 hours of power is not subject to the same scrutiny that would if it is sold as a drink. The FDA has received reports of heart attacks, seizures, and spontaneous abortions related to drinking.
Top 4 best energy drinks
# 4: Coffee
normal black coffee with no added sugar or milk is low in calories and gives a boost caffeine to wake up. In addition, caffeine to help you burn fat faster! Coffee itself has numerous health benefits, especially protecting you from diseases like Parkinson's, Alzheimer's and liver disease.
# 3: Green tea
While green tea contains caffeine, which also has the L-theanine, which also gives a boost of energy. Green tea is well known as a metabolism booster that gives energy without spiking the level of blood sugar.
# 2: smoothies and milkshakes
A protein shake as an energy drink? If true! Milkshakes and smoothies are a great way to feed your body with long-lasting energy. The use of fruits and totally natural juices are a natural source of sugar. Supplements such as ginger, coconut water, wheat grass, ginseng, and beet juice are natural energy boosters. The fiber in whole fruits and vegetables combined with proteins that give an energy boost that lasts.
# 1: Water
Believe it or not, one of the main reasons for their lack of energy could be dehydration . It is one of the first signs of our body used to tell us we need more water. Rehydration improves metabolic functions of your body and gives you an instant energy boost. If water is boring for you, try adding fruit to taste.
